Data Visualization
Visualizing data turns raw numbers into meaningful patterns. It is like reading the room instead of stumbling in the dark. Project managers gain clarity and precision through advanced tools such as Power BI, making every decision count. Charts and dashboards present project metrics, labor costs, and timelines in an easy-to-grasp format.
Imagine you are tracking multiple construction sites; these visuals let you spot trends quickly without sifting through spreadsheets. This ensures resources are allocated efficiently, deadlines are met smoothly, and surprises stay minimal.
It also creates a harmonious flow of information across teams so everyone is on the same page – from architects to contractors – leading to more streamlined operations overall.
Predictive Analytics
As data visualization brings clarity, predictive analytics offer foresight. With historical and real-time data combined, construction teams anticipate challenges before they arise. This proactive approach enhances efficiency by reducing costly downtime and rework.
You might be overseeing a high-rise project with potential weather disruptions. Predictive tools analyze past patterns alongside current forecasts to provide strategies that mitigate delays.
Machine learning models refine predictions continuously, adapting as projects progress. As a result, construction sites become more resilient to uncertainties and capable of sustaining momentum even amidst unexpected changes in conditions or resources.
IoT Sensors
IoT sensors are another game changer in construction. These tiny devices monitor everything from temperature to equipment usage, providing data that informs decision-making on the fly.
You oversee a project where energy efficiency is crucial. Sensors track electricity consumption and pinpoint areas for optimization. They also enhance safety by monitoring structural integrity and alerting teams to potential hazards.
The continuous stream of information allows managers to respond swiftly, preventing issues before they escalate into costly setbacks. Project timelines become more predictable as inefficiencies are addressed promptly, contributing significantly to improved project outcomes.
Digital Twin Technology
After leveraging IoT sensors, digital twin technology takes the data to another level. It creates virtual replicas of physical structures, allowing managers to visualize and test scenarios without stepping onto the site.
Think of it as a simulation game but with real stakes. Changes made in the digital model reveal how they affect timelines and budgets before implementation.
For example, if you are working on a bridge construction project, digital twin technology simulates stress tests or material changes, highlighting potential issues long before ground-breaking occurs. The process saves both time and money by catching mistakes early.
AI-Powered Scheduling
Another technological marvel is AI-powered scheduling. This tool analyzes vast datasets to create optimal project timelines, taking constraints and resources into account. For example, if you are handling a large-scale construction site where multiple teams work simultaneously. AI algorithms adjust schedules in real time, accommodating delays or unexpected changes.
It considers weather forecasts, supply chain issues, and labor availability with incredible speed and precision. As a result, projects move forward with minimal hiccups.
Automated alerts features on the tools keep everyone informed of timeline adjustments, fostering better coordination among stakeholders. The result is reduced idle times and more efficient use of manpower – maximizing productivity across the board.
Augmented Reality (AR) in Construction
Augmented reality has increasingly become a game changer in construction by bringing designs to life right before your eyes. This technology overlays digital information onto the physical world, offering an interactive way to visualize projects. Imagine standing on a construction site with AR glasses; virtual elements like beams and walls align perfectly with existing structures.
It is particularly helpful for identifying potential clashes between systems such as plumbing or electrical wiring. Contractors can explore multiple designs or configurations without touching the real structure.
This immediate feedback loop reduces errors during execution, ensuring smoother workflows and fewer costly adjustments later on. It also helps clients get a clear view of what to expect which plays a huge part in managing expectations.
